Seller Spotlight: Watson from Upcycle

October 17, 2023 12:24pm by rob
This week's Seller Spotlight is on Watson, the co-founder of Upcycle, a new peer-to-peer bike rental marketplace. He has a bunch of parts sitting around from riding and owning lots of bikes over the last several years. Some cool ones include a SRAM GX Eagle crankset and a Specialized S-Works Romin saddle.

And now for our five easy questions!

How did you get into bikes?
I’ve been riding bikes most of my life. I started riding dirt jump bikes in high school which somehow evolved into cross-country racing. Growing up, I raced for my high school cross-country team in Petaluma California, at Casa Grande High School. After graduating, I sold my mountain bikes and bought a road bike and a fixed gear which I used to ride around in college at UC Davis. Now that I’m an adult, I have all the bikes again! N+1 as they say.

What bike do you ride the most?
The bike that has the most miles is my Baum cyclocross bike which I use mostly as a road bike.

What is your favorite bike ride?
For mountain biking, I like Demo Forest in Santa Cruz. For road biking it’s hard to beat riding in Mallorca.

Campy or Shimano?
Sram because it’s what I’m used to and their road brake levers don’t have lateral movement. But I would heavily consider Campy on a future road build!

Any big plans for the next year?
Continuing work on Upcycle, racing BC Bike Race 2024, going to Bentonville, finishing a Dario Pegoretti build that my wife bought me, and riding bikes wherever life takes me!



Seller Spotlight: Justin from I Know A Guy Bicycles

May 3, 2023 6:13pm by rob
This week's Seller Spotlight is on Justin from I Know A Guy Bicycles. He currently has several bikes for sale on BikeList, including--a 2006 Specialized Roubaix Comp and a 2006 Felt F75. Both are great values and fully tuned up by a guy who knows his way around a bike!

Justin also recently posted this awesome review of BikeList on YouTube. Be sure to check it out and subscribe to his channel.



And now for our five easy questions!

How did you get into bikes?
My passion for bikes started when my parents opened a shop in the 1980s, called Parker Bikes (we were located in Parker, Colorado). My love for cycling has continued since then, in my work and with my hobbies of road cycling and mountain biking. After my parents’ shop closed, I’ve worked for other bike shops (including Lee’s Cyclery in Fort Collins), where I’ve built and sold bikes, fixed and tuned-up bikes, and managed inventory. I'm still a bike shop kid and love doing what I do.

What bike do you ride the most?
In the 90s, I raced mountain bikes, and in 2000 my cyclocross and now road bikes since there are over a hundred of miles of bike trails and safe roads to ride right out of my doorstep.

What is your favorite bike ride?
Currently, my Lemond Poprad and my Klein Quantum Race. I have too many favorites and collections.

Campy or Shimano?
Shimano, just mainly because that is what I mostly worked on over the last 30 years.

Any big plans for the next year?
From doing mechanical support for the MS 150 (Colorado Chapter) to providing more better quality bikes for those just getting into cycling. I would like to document and provide YouTube videos to share those insights and experiences.
